After nearly two months at sea, an important part of the port city is coming home today.
The US Coast Guard cutter Diligence left in early August to help patrol the windward pass to stop illegal immigration. The crew stopped dozens of Haitian migrants from coming into the US.
During their time at sea the Diligence crew encountered hurricanes Fay, Gustav, Hanna and Ike. The crew also went to the Bahamas to help in recovery efforts from Hurricane Ike.
The Diligence will dock around noon today.
